How they compare
Israel currently reports 0.0015 Mt CO2e against 0.0011 Mt CO2e in Denmark, a difference of 0.0004 Mt CO2e.
That makes Israel's figure about 1.4 times Denmark's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 55 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Israel ahead.
Denmark ranks 121st and Israel ranks 118th of 187 countries.
Israel has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Denmark | Israel |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 0.001 Mt CO2e | 0.0017 Mt CO2e | 0.0007 Mt CO2e | Israel |
| 1980s | 0.0017 Mt CO2e | 0.0029 Mt CO2e | 0.0012 Mt CO2e | Israel |
| 1990s | 0.0027 Mt CO2e | 0.0046 Mt CO2e | 0.002 Mt CO2e | Israel |
| 2000s | 0.0028 Mt CO2e | 0.005 Mt CO2e | 0.0022 Mt CO2e | Israel |
| 2010s | 0.002 Mt CO2e | 0.0022 Mt CO2e | 0.0002 Mt CO2e | Israel |
| 2020s | 0.0012 Mt CO2e | 0.0014 Mt CO2e | 0.0002 Mt CO2e | Israel |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
A measure of annual emissions of nitrous oxide (N2O), one of the six Kyoto greenhouse gases (GHG), from fugitive emissions (subsector of the energy sector) including IPCC 2006 codes 1.A.1.bc Petroleum Refining - Manufacture of Solid Fuels and Other Energy Industries, 1.B.1 Solid Fuels, 1.B.2 Oil and Natural Gas, 5.B.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
